Aman was a young graduate, eager to start his career but unsure of where to begin. Like many others, he dreamed of quick success and a fulfilling job that paid well. However, he didn’t know how to make it happen in a short time. He had seen others struggle for years, jumping from job to job with little progress. Aman wanted something different. He was determined to build a successful career quickly, without wasting time.

One evening, while talking to his cousin, who had become a successful entrepreneur in just three years, Aman asked, “How did you do it? How did you manage to build your career so fast?”

His cousin smiled and said, “Success in a short time isn’t about luck or knowing the right people. It’s about focus, strategy, and taking action. Let me share with you a few steps that helped me.”

Step 1: Set Clear Goals

The first thing Aman learned was the importance of setting clear and specific goals. His cousin explained, “When I first started, I knew exactly what I wanted: to create a successful business in digital marketing. I didn’t waste time on things that didn’t align with that goal.”

Aman realized that he had been too vague in his own ambitions. He decided to sit down and write out his career goals. He wanted to work in marketing for a top company, learn fast, and rise quickly within the organization. Having these clear goals gave him direction and helped him stay focused on what he wanted to achieve.

Step 2: Develop the Right Skills

Next, Aman’s cousin emphasized the importance of having the right skills. “I didn’t wait for opportunities to come to me,” his cousin said. “I learned everything I could about digital marketing—courses, online resources, and even free tools. I made sure I was prepared for any opportunity.”

Aman realized that to move fast in his career, he needed to develop skills that were in demand. He started researching the skills that top marketing professionals had and immediately enrolled in online courses on data analytics, content strategy, and social media management. He spent his evenings learning and practicing these skills, knowing that this investment in himself would pay off soon.

Step 3: Network Strategically

His cousin then shared the importance of networking. “You have to meet the right people. But networking isn’t just about attending events and shaking hands. It’s about building meaningful relationships with people who can help you and whom you can help in return.”

Aman knew that he needed to expand his network, so he started attending industry conferences and workshops. He connected with professionals in the marketing field, joined relevant online groups, and reached out to mentors who could guide him. But he didn’t stop there—he made sure to add value to every interaction. Whether it was sharing helpful insights or offering assistance, Aman built a reputation as someone who was both knowledgeable and generous.

Step 4: Be Open to Opportunities

Opportunities can come from unexpected places, his cousin explained. “I didn’t just wait for job offers to come to me. I volunteered for projects, did freelance work, and even took internships in the beginning to build my portfolio. That’s how I got my foot in the door.”

Aman decided to take this advice to heart. He didn’t just rely on job applications. He started freelancing for small companies and taking on marketing projects that allowed him to showcase his skills. This not only helped him gain practical experience but also made him stand out to potential employers. Soon, he started getting job offers from companies that noticed his work.

Step 5: Take Calculated Risks

Aman’s cousin shared one last crucial lesson: “To grow quickly, you need to be willing to take risks, but they should be smart risks. I left my stable job to start my own business. It wasn’t easy, but I did my homework. I knew it was a risk worth taking.”

Aman realized that in order to move ahead fast, he couldn’t play it safe all the time. He had to take bold steps. After working in his first marketing role for just a few months, he saw an opportunity at a growing startup that needed someone to lead their marketing efforts. It was a risky move—it was a small company with no guarantees—but Aman decided to go for it.

He used all the skills he had learned and the connections he had made to drive the startup’s marketing forward. His work paid off, and within a year, the company’s growth skyrocketed. Aman’s contributions didn’t go unnoticed—he was promoted to a senior position, much faster than he had ever expected.

Step 6: Stay Consistent and Keep Learning

Even after achieving early success, Aman didn’t stop working on himself. “The key to long-term success,” his cousin reminded him, “is staying consistent and never getting too comfortable. Keep learning and adapting.”

Aman took this advice seriously. He continued to learn new marketing trends, attend workshops, and expand his knowledge. He knew that his career was not just about short-term success but building a foundation that would last.

The Path to Quick Success

In just a few short years, Aman had gone from a confused graduate to a successful marketing professional in a leadership role. His journey wasn’t easy, but by setting clear goals, developing the right skills, networking strategically, taking risks, and staying consistent, he was able to achieve his career goals faster than he had ever imagined.

Aman’s story shows that building a successful career in a short time is possible. It’s not about luck or shortcuts—it’s about being focused, taking action, and staying committed to your growth. If you follow the same principles, your career can take off faster than you ever thought possible.
